Output deff73218cbb5912dce0768ee3ad9739d9e206b032abaa18582b33fb97dd9b07:24

value
144755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da978a38fe4b13aba29b659498032e9dfd6cb1d7 OP_EQUAL
address
3McpmYP52ois3yvA32YvkQGGaxBrRtsC36
transaction
deff73218cbb5912dce0768ee3ad9739d9e206b032abaa18582b33fb97dd9b07
confirmations
152026
spent
true